A63 crash causes Hull commuter traffic chaos
Commuters are facing delays after a crash on the A63 this morning.
A car has ended up facing the wrong way and lamppost is leaning into the road, opposite the Holiday Inn, following the single vehicle accident at around 7am.
One lane is closed eastbound and traffic is queueing from the Waterhouse Lane junction to the Prince's Dock Street junction.
There is further congestion right along to St Andrews Quay and to the A1165 Great Union Street junction.
